-1

我有一个 node.js Express Web 应用程序,我需要与来自 COIN-OR 的名为 CBC 的优化库交谈:

https://projects.coin-or.org/Cbc

使用 node.js 与这个库交谈的最佳方式是什么?我可以围绕 C++ 库创建一个 node.js 包装器还是...?

4

1 回答 1

2

如果您关心性能,那么编写一个包含库的插件(和/或可能nan用于让插件跨主要 node.js/io.js 版本工作)是最好的解决方案。

如果不考虑对性能造成相当大的影响,您可以使用ffi“直接”从 javascript 调用库。

于 2015-03-29T05:02:43.613 回答